Активность пользователя за последние 12 месяцев [1.0]

Описание

Открытый метод, отдающий статистику за последние 12 месяцев. Доступен только платным пользователям.

Бесплатный пользователь видит только статистику активности только своего аккаунта.

Счетчик - возвращает число дней в месяце, в которые осуществлялась активность.

Структура URL

HTTP метод: GET BaseUrl/v1.0/activities/statistics/{atiId}/year

Список параметров:

НазваниеОписаниеСпособ передачи параметраОбязательный
AtiID

AtiID фирмы, для которой необходимо получить статистику активности за последние 12 месяцев

URLДа


Пример запроса и ответа

Запрос

http://api.ati.su/v1.0/activities/statistics/1054756/year


Ответ

Json вида


{
    "atiId": "1054756",
    "statisticItems": {
        "other": {
            "zone": 1,
            "stats": {
                "2018-05-01T00:00:00": 13,
                "2018-06-01T00:00:00": 18,
                "2018-07-01T00:00:00": 14,
                "2018-08-01T00:00:00": 13,
                "2018-09-01T00:00:00": 11,
                "2018-10-01T00:00:00": 15,
                "2018-11-01T00:00:00": 21,
                "2018-12-01T00:00:00": 15,
                "2019-01-01T00:00:00": 9,
                "2019-02-01T00:00:00": 16,
                "2019-03-01T00:00:00": 12,
                "2019-04-01T00:00:00": 17,
                "2019-05-01T00:00:00": 6
            }
        },
        "truck_search": {
            "zone": 2,
            "stats": {
                "2018-05-01T00:00:00": 2,
                "2018-06-01T00:00:00": 5,
                "2018-07-01T00:00:00": 2,
                "2018-08-01T00:00:00": 3,
                "2018-09-01T00:00:00": 2,
                "2018-10-01T00:00:00": 1,
                "2018-11-01T00:00:00": 4,
                "2018-12-01T00:00:00": 2,
                "2019-03-01T00:00:00": 1
            }
        },
        "load_search": {
            "zone": 4,
            "stats": {
                "2018-06-01T00:00:00": 10,
                "2018-07-01T00:00:00": 4,
                "2018-08-01T00:00:00": 7,
                "2018-09-01T00:00:00": 7,
                "2018-10-01T00:00:00": 5,
                "2018-11-01T00:00:00": 4,
                "2018-12-01T00:00:00": 5,
                "2019-02-01T00:00:00": 5,
                "2019-03-01T00:00:00": 7,
                "2019-04-01T00:00:00": 3
            }
        },
        "add_truck": {
            "zone": 8,
            "stats": {
                "2018-06-01T00:00:00": 2,
                "2018-09-01T00:00:00": 1,
                "2018-11-01T00:00:00": 1,
                "2019-02-01T00:00:00": 1
            }
        },
        "add_load": {
            "zone": 16,
            "stats": {
                "2018-06-01T00:00:00": 2,
                "2019-04-01T00:00:00": 1
            }
        },
        "forum": {
            "zone": 32,
            "stats": {
                "2018-05-01T00:00:00": 9,
                "2018-06-01T00:00:00": 15,
                "2018-07-01T00:00:00": 6,
                "2018-08-01T00:00:00": 6,
                "2018-09-01T00:00:00": 8,
                "2018-10-01T00:00:00": 9,
                "2018-11-01T00:00:00": 6,
                "2018-12-01T00:00:00": 6,
                "2019-01-01T00:00:00": 2,
                "2019-02-01T00:00:00": 4,
                "2019-03-01T00:00:00": 3,
                "2019-04-01T00:00:00": 12,
                "2019-05-01T00:00:00": 2
            }
        },
        "add_forum_msg": {
            "zone": 64,
            "stats": {
                "2018-06-01T00:00:00": 3,
                "2018-07-01T00:00:00": 3,
                "2018-09-01T00:00:00": 1,
                "2018-10-01T00:00:00": 2,
                "2019-02-01T00:00:00": 1,
                "2019-04-01T00:00:00": 2,
                "2019-05-01T00:00:00": 1
            }
        },
        "tender": {
            "zone": 128,
            "stats": {
                "2018-05-01T00:00:00": 3,
                "2018-06-01T00:00:00": 2,
                "2018-07-01T00:00:00": 3,
                "2018-08-01T00:00:00": 1,
                "2018-09-01T00:00:00": 3,
                "2018-10-01T00:00:00": 3,
                "2018-11-01T00:00:00": 3,
                "2018-12-01T00:00:00": 2,
                "2019-04-01T00:00:00": 1
            }
        },
        "users_count_on_firm_boards": {
            "zone": 524288,
            "stats": {
                "2019-04-01T00:00:00": 0,
                "2019-05-01T00:00:00": 0
            }
        },
        "firm_participations_count": {
            "zone": 1048576,
            "stats": {
                "2019-04-01T00:00:00": 2,
                "2019-05-01T00:00:00": 2
            }
        },
        "own_deals_finished": {
            "zone": 256,
            "stats": {}
        },
        "deals_finished": {
            "zone": 512,
            "stats": {}
        },
        "own_deals_declined_by_me": {
            "zone": 1024,
            "stats": {}
        },
        "own_deals_declined": {
            "zone": 2048,
            "stats": {}
        },
        "deals_declined_by_me": {
            "zone": 4096,
            "stats": {}
        },
        "deals_declined": {
            "zone": 8192,
            "stats": {}
        },
        "own_auction_finished": {
            "zone": 16384,
            "stats": {}
        },
        "auction_participated": {
            "zone": 32768,
            "stats": {}
        },
        "auction_won": {
            "zone": 65536,
            "stats": {}
        },
        "loads_count": {
            "zone": 131072,
            "stats": {}
        },
        "exclusive_loads_count": {
            "zone": 262144,
            "stats": {}
        }
    }
}

Описание зон

ЗонаНазвание зоныОписание
Zone 1"other"Заход на сайт
Zone 2"truck_search"Поиск машин
Zone 4"load_search"Поиск грузов
Zone 8"add_truck"Размещение машин
Zone 16"add_load"Размещение грузов
Zone 32"forum"Просмотр форумов
Zone 64"add_forum_msg"Сообщение на форум
Zone 128"tender"

Поиск тендеров

Zone 256"own_deals_finished"Количество завершенных сделок, где пользователь - владелец
Zone 512"deals_finished"Количество завершенных сделок, где пользователь - участник
Zone 1024"own_deals_declined_by_me"Количество отказов от сделок, где пользователь - владелец
Zone 2048"own_deals_declined"Количество отказов от сделок, где пользователь - участник
Zone 4096"deals_declined_by_me"Количество отказов от сделок, где пользователь - перевозчик (он отказался)
Zone 8192"deals_declined"Количество отказов от сделок, где пользователь перевозчик (ему отказали)
Zone 16384"own_auction_finished"Количество завершенных аукционов, где пользователь - владелец
Zone 32768"auction_participated"Количество аукционов, в которых пользователь принимал участие
Zone 65536"auction_won"Количество аукционов, в которых пользователь победил
Zone 131072"loads_count"Количество грузов, добавленных на общую площадку + на личные площадки
Zone 262144"exclusive_loads_count"Количество грузов. добавленных только на личные площадки
Zone 524288 "users_count_on_firm_boards"Количество участников на площадках пользователя
Zone 1048576 "firm_participations_count"Количество площадок, где фирма участвует

Список ответов сервера

НТТP код ответаКод ошибкиСообщение
200
Операция успешно завершена
401
Неавторизованный пользователь
403
У пользователя недостаточно прав